Constituent meeting of Committee to Protect Rights of Rauf Arifoglu

A constituent meeting of the Committee to Protect Rights of Rauf Arifoglu, editor-in-chief of the opposition newspaper Yeni Musavat arrested on October 27 in connection with the October 15 and 16 events, was held at the International Press Club on January 22. Directors of the leading media and journalistic organizations, members of political parties and human rights activists participated in it.

Speakers called upon the public to support them in their struggle for the journalist's rights. Yadigar Mamedli, head of the NGO League of Journalists, was elected chairman of the Committee.

  • Activist Olga Begretova loses appeal in forced fingerprinting case

    The Supreme Court of the Kabardino-Balkarian Republic (KBR) has rejected the appeal complaint, lodged by Olga Begretova, an activist, against the decision of the Nalchik court, which refused to request information that the FSB had received about her after forced fingerprinting at the airport. This was reported by the Memorial Centre for Human Rights Defence* in its website.

  • ECtHR awards compensation to Ingush activist Zarifa Sautieva

    The European Court of Human Rights (ECtHR) found that the Russian authorities violated the article on the prohibition of torture and inhuman treatment in relation to Ingush activist Zarifa Sautieva. The activist was awarded 1000 euros in compensation, although Russia does not consider itself obligated to comply with the decisions of the European Court.

  • Court dismisses appeal of activist Melikhova against fine for her verse

    A court dismissed all the arguments of the defence and upheld the decision to fine Marina Melikhova, an activist from Kuban, whose verse the law enforcement bodies recognized as discrediting the Russian Armed Forces. Marina Melikhova, who does not have the money to pay the fine, intends to file an appeal against the court’s decision.
